Marina Braun
Paris - France
I transform unsold newspapers into eco-bags.
0 Like
Partager
Seeing the misery of the inhabitants of Angong near Phnom Penh in Cambodia, Marina came up with the idea to collect unsold French newspapers and transform them in a creative way in this slum. A real breath of fresh air.
